Abstract:Objective Streptococcus pneumoniae has long been one of the most important bacterial pathogen causing acute lower respiratory tract infection (ALRI) . Currently the rapid, sensitive and specific tests are not available which can be used for etio-logic diagnosis of ALRI. The present study was designed to determine the effect of pneumococcal antigen in urine (UPA) on clinical diagnosis of pneumococcal infections. Methods The subjects involved 210 patients aged 0 - 3 years old with clinical and roentgeno-graphic evidence of acute lower respiratory tract infection attending Shanghai Children's Hospital from Sep 2000 to Feb 2001. For individual patient, urine specimen was collected for detecting UPA by Immunochromatographic test (ICT) , and sputum specimen for culture. Steptococcus pneumoniae (Sp) was identified by optochin sensitivity and bile solubility. Results Of 210 patients the detection rates of UPA were 33.8% .The isolation rates of Sp from sputum specimens were 32.9%. The rates of UPA in positive group were apparently higher than that of negative group ( P < 0.01) . The sensitivity, specificity and accuracy of UPA by ICT were 85.2%, 88.7% and 87.7% respectively. Conclusions ICT for detection of UPA, a relative sensitive and specific test, is useful for aiding clinical diagnosis of pneumococcal infections.
